Persimmon Fruit Salad

Prep: 15 min Serves: 5

A vibrant and refreshing persimmon fruit salad combining citrus, apples, bananas, and walnuts, dressed with creamy mayonnaise and whipped cream — perfect for light, colorful gatherings.

Ingredients

  • 11 oz. can mandarin oranges, drained
  • 2 cups diced apple
  • 2 bananas, sliced
  • 1/2 cup peeled, sliced persimmons
  • 1/4 cup chopped black walnuts
  • 1/2 cup salad dressing or mayonnaise
  • 1/4 cup whipped cream
  • 1 teaspoon sugar

Instructions

  1. Combine the mandarin oranges, diced apple, sliced bananas, sliced persimmons, and chopped black walnuts in a bowl, stirring gently.
  2. In a separate bowl, mix the salad dressing or mayonnaise, whipped cream, and sugar until well combined.
  3. Pour the dressing over the fruit mixture.
  4. Toss lightly to coat all the fruit evenly.
  5. Chill in the refrigerator for 1 to 2 hours before serving.
